What is Drip Real-Time Reporting?
Drip real-time reporting refers to the ability to monitor and analyze the performance of your email marketing campaigns as they happen. Unlike traditional reporting, which may provide insights after the fact, real-time reporting allows marketers to make immediate adjustments to optimize their campaigns. This capability is crucial for understanding audience behavior and engagement, ultimately leading to better results and higher conversion rates.

Key Metrics in Drip Real-Time Reporting
When utilizing drip real-time reporting, several key metrics should be monitored closely. Open rates indicate how many recipients opened your email, while click-through rates reveal how many clicked on the links within. Additionally, tracking bounce rates and unsubscribes can provide valuable insights into the health of your email list. By focusing on these metrics, marketers can gain a comprehensive understanding of their campaign’s performance.

Challenges in Real-Time Reporting
While the advantages of drip real-time reporting are significant, there are challenges to consider. The sheer volume of data can be overwhelming, and without the right tools, interpreting this data can be difficult. Additionally, marketers must ensure they are not making impulsive decisions based solely on real-time data, as this can lead to inconsistent messaging and a lack of strategic direction.
